Blazing Heat Produces Big Crowds at Mentor Pools

Kids describe the feeling they get when jumping in the pool on a day that approached 90 degrees.

A week full of 80-degree temperatures illustrates just how valuable how it is to have plenty of opportunities to cool off in one city.

Mentor Recreation Superintendent Paul Hegreness said about 2,500 people took advantage of the city's three pools on Tuesday alone. Nearly 1,800 people visited Civic Center Pool that day, along with 500 at Garfield and 300 at Morton.

Another 500 or so visited Walsh Spray Park that day.

"On these kinds of days, what an asset it is to have these pools," Hegreness said.

That sentiment wasn't lost on youngsters like Noah and Gabe, who are twins, and Liam who all describe the feeling they get when they first jump in the pool in the video above. They all enjoyed cooling down a bit at Garfield this week.
